#d9da31 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#d9da31 is composed of 85.1% red, 85.5%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 77.5%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 60.4 degrees, a saturation of 69.5% and a lightness of 52.4%. #d9da31 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ff62 with #b3b500.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

● #d9da31 color description : Bright yellow.
The hexadecimal color #d9da31 has RGB values of R:217, G:218, B:49 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0, Y:0.78,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14277169.
